文件速传:Win10虚拟机接收指南
文件发送到win10虚拟机

首页 2025-01-25 20:41:59



文件传输至Win10虚拟机:高效、安全与便捷的实践指南 在当今多元化计算环境中,虚拟机(Virtual Machine, VM)作为一种强大的技术工具,为开发者、测试人员乃至日常用户提供了前所未有的灵活性和隔离性

    Windows 10虚拟机,凭借其广泛的兼容性、丰富的应用生态以及强大的性能表现,成为了众多场景下的首选解决方案

    无论是为了跨平台开发、旧软件运行,还是出于安全测试的需求,Win10虚拟机都能游刃有余地应对

    然而,要充分发挥虚拟机的潜力,高效、安全地将文件从宿主机传输到虚拟机内部,是一项基础而关键的操作

    本文将深入探讨这一过程中的最佳实践,确保您能够无缝、安全地完成文件传输

     一、理解文件传输的基本需求与挑战 在使用Win10虚拟机的过程中,文件传输是连接宿主机与虚拟机资源的关键桥梁

    无论是源代码、数据集、设计稿还是日常办公文档,这些文件的及时同步对于提高工作效率至关重要

    然而,文件传输并非总是一帆风顺,常见挑战包括: 1.兼容性问题:不同操作系统间的文件格式差异可能导致传输失败或数据损坏

     2.安全性考量:未经授权的文件传输可能暴露于安全风险之中,如恶意软件感染

     3.效率瓶颈:大文件传输可能受到网络带宽、虚拟机性能限制,影响传输速度

     4.易用性不足:复杂的操作步骤会增加用户的学习成本,降低使用体验

     针对上述挑战,本文将逐一提出解决方案,旨在帮助用户实现高效、安全的文件传输

     二、选用合适的传输工具与方法 2.1 共享文件夹 共享文件夹是虚拟机与宿主机之间文件传输最直接、最常用的方法之一

    大多数虚拟化软件(如VMware Workstation、VirtualBox等)都内置了共享文件夹功能,允许用户轻松设置并访问

     设置步骤: 1. 在虚拟化软件界面中找到“设置”或“配置”选项

     2. 选择“共享文件夹”功能,添加一个新的共享文件夹

     3. 指定宿主机上的文件夹路径,并设置访问权限(只读/读写)

     4. 启动或重启虚拟机,进入Win10系统后,通过“网络”或特定的虚拟机共享文件夹访问路径找到并访问该文件夹

     - 优势:设置简单,支持自动同步,适用于大多数日常文件传输需求

     - 注意事项:确保防火墙和杀毒软件不会阻止访问,同时定期检查共享权限,避免安全漏洞

     2.2 云存储服务 利用云存储服务(如Dropbox、Google Drive、OneDrive等)作为中介,可以实现跨设备、跨平台的文件同步与分享

     操作步骤: 1. 在宿主机和Win10虚拟机上分别安装并登录同一云存储服务客户端

     2. 将需要传输的文件上传至云存储账户

     3. 在Win10虚拟机内,通过云存储客户端下载所需文件

     - 优势:无需复杂配置,支持多设备同步,适合远程协作和移动办公场景

     - 注意事项:注意隐私设置,避免敏感信息泄露;同时,大文件上传下载可能受网络速度影响

     2.3 SCP/SFTP协议 对于需要更高安全性的文件传输,可以使用SCP(Secure Copy Protocol)或SFTP(SSH File Transfer Protocol)

    这些协议基于SSH加密,能有效防止数据在传输过程中被窃听或篡改

     操作步骤: 1. 在宿主机上安装支持SCP/SFTP的客户端软件(如WinSCP)

     2. 配置虚拟机以允许SSH连接,通常需要在Win10中安装OpenSSH服务器

     3. 使用客户端软件连接到虚拟机,通过图形界面或命令行方式上传/下载文件

     优势:高度安全,适用于传输敏感数据

     - 注意事项:需要一定的技术基础进行配置;虚拟机需开放SSH端口,并注意防火墙设置

     三、优化传输效率与安全性 3.1 优化传输速度 - 调整虚拟化软件设置:增加分配给虚拟机的内存和CPU资源,提升整体性能

     - 使用高速存储介质:将共享文件夹或虚拟机文件存储在SSD上,而非传统HDD,可以显著提高读写速度

     - 限制同时传输的文件数量:大批量小文件传输时,考虑打包成单个压缩文件,减少传输开销

     3.2 强化安全性 - 定期更新软件:确保虚拟化软件、操作系统、防病毒软件均为最新版本,以减少已知漏洞

     - 实施访问控制:严格管理共享文件夹的访问权限,遵循最小权限原则

     - 加密传输:对于通过网络传输的文件,尤其是使用云存储服务时,启用端到端加密功能

     四、实战案例分享 为了更好地理解上述方法的应用,以下提供一个实战案例: 场景:一名开发者需要在宿主机(Mac OS)上的项目文件夹与Win10虚拟机内的开发环境之间进行频繁的文件同步

     解决方案: 1.选择共享文件夹:利用VMware Fusion的共享文件夹功能,将Mac上的项目文件夹设置为共享

    在Win10虚拟机中,通过“网络位置”访问该文件夹,实现实时同步

     2.辅助使用云存储:对于需要与团队成员共享的设计稿和文档,使用OneDrive进行同步

    这样,即使在外出时也能通过Win10虚拟机或其他设备访问最新文件

     3.安全传输敏感数据:对于包含敏感信息的代码库,通过SCP协议从宿主机传输至虚拟机,确保数据在传输过程中的安全性

     通过上述方案,该开发者不仅实现了高效的文件传输,还确保了数据的安全性和隐私保护,极大地提升了工作效率

     五、结语 文件传输至Win10虚拟机,虽看似简单,实则涉及多方面的考量

    从选择合适的传输工具,到优化传输效率与强化安全性,每一步都需要细致规划与执行

    本文提供的指南和方法,旨在帮助用户克服常见挑战,实现无缝、高效、安全的文件传输体验

    无论是个人用户还是企业团队,掌握这些技巧都将为日常工作和项目推进带来显著便利

    随着技术的不断进步,未来还将有更多创新方案涌现,让我们共同期待更加便捷、智能的文件传输新时代

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道